Unless we are out of town or away from the boat for an extended period, the engine intake valve is left open. All the others are closed when we are not aboard.
This regimen works for me, and no way would I promote it for others.....
Best advice is always to close 'em all when you are gone.
Also, I have replaced *all* of the 1988 OEM Marelon RC Marine thruhulls with the later ForeSpar model 93 seacocks.
There are no original bilge hoses remaining in the boat -- all have been replaced, some twice.
(As my friend Bob will tell you, after narrowly avoiding sinking, quality hoses, clamps, and thruhulls are a Big Deal.)
